What is The Flight That Fought Back (2005) about?
This documentary recounts the bravery of passengers on United Flight 93 who fought back against terrorists on September 11, 2001. Using recovered voice recordings and family accounts, it reveals how 40 strangers became unlikely heroes in a desperate bid to save lives.

About The Flight That Fought Back (2005) — The Untold Story of Flight 93's Defiant Last Stand
Bruce Goodison's gripping 2005 documentary *The Flight That Fought Back* plunges viewers into the harrowing events of September 11, 2001, focusing on the passengers of United Flight 93 who turned the tide against terrorism. Through chilling voice recordings, heartfelt testimonies from loved ones, and dramatic reenactments, the film reconstructs the 30-minute rebellion that thwarted the hijackers' plans. It's a raw, emotional journey that honors ordinary people thrust into extraordinary circumstances, blending documentary realism with profound human drama. The atmosphere is tense yet respectful, capturing both the gravity of the tragedy and the resilience it inspired across the nation.
